An evaluation of the amplitude jitter and timing jitter for a regeneratively mode-locked fibre laser via the use of the harmonic analysis approach is presented. The RF power spectrum of four harmonics derived from a 10 GHz mode-locked pulse train was measured with high resolution. From a detailed analysis of the noise pedestal present in these harmonics, an amplitude jitter of approximate to 0.3% and an absolute timing jitter of approximate to 41 fs are obtained.
